About us
Apple Plumbing, Heating, & Air is a family owned and operated full-service Plumbing and HVAC company. They offer plumbing, HVAC, and Water Treatment services to home owners, businesses, and property management companies. Apple Plumbing, Heating, & Air serves the greater Baltimore region, including Baltimore, Carroll, Frederick, and Howard Counties. They have been in business since 1994 and are dedicated to providing its customers with the highest quality service so that any problem is as unobtrusive as possible. Apple Plumbing, Heating, & Air offers its customer a full range of Plumbing and HVAC products and services. They also offer 24/7 emergency service to better satisfy customer's needs. Apple Plumbing, Heating, & Air is fully licensed and insured. All subcontractors used by Apple Plumbing, Heating, & Air are as equally licensed and insured.
